dc.description.abstractThis article is the fourth in the Asian Journal of Mycology Notes series, enabling researchers to report 50 new fungal collections, including fungus-host and fungus-taxa. Herewith, we report the distribution of taxa in two phyla (Ascomycota and Basidiomycota), four classes (Dothideomycetes, Leotiomycetes, Sordariomycetes, and Agaricomycetes), 18 orders, and 30 families. The present study provides descriptions and illustrations for six new species (Amniculicola yunnanensis, Melanographium reniforme, Mucispora yunnanensis, Neomassaria yunnanensis, Neoarthrinium bambusae, and Tryblidiopsis xizangensis), 19 new records, 19 new host records, and five new host and geographical records. This article aims to enhance knowledge of novel fungi, their host occurrence, and geography reports. Comprehensive descriptions, illustrations, and multi-gene phylogenetic trees show the placements of the described taxa. Additionally, a platform for disseminating data on fungal collections, including new sequence data, could support future studies.
